预览加载中,请您耐心等待几秒...
1/10
2/10
3/10
4/10
5/10
6/10
7/10
8/10
9/10
10/10

亲,该文档总共40页,到这已经超出免费预览范围,如果喜欢就直接下载吧~

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

本科毕业论文(科研训练、毕业设计)题目:凭证管理及报表分析系统姓名:陈肖如学院:软件学院系:软件工程专业:软件工程年级:2003级学号:03368004指导教师(校内):史亮职称:讲师指导教师(校外):王磊职称:工程师2005年6月2日凭证管理及报表分析系统[摘要]我国加入WTO以后我国金融业将面临来自国外的竞争也给中国金融业带来了压力如何利用更加科学和高效的手段对经营数据进行分析是商业银行业务发展的需要。在此背景下我们开发了凭证管理及报表分析系统。该系统采用J2EE架构使用了MVC模式并以目前较为流行的基于J2EE的应用程序框架Struts作为开发框架尝试了J2EE在信息管理领域和数据统计领域中的应用。凭证管理及报表分析系统是基于Web的凭证及报表的生成打印系统。该系统可以协助银行管理人员管理特种转帐明细记录并从中获取有价值的统计信息从而达到管理分析和决策支持的目的。[关键词]J2EEStrutsB/S架构MVC模型JavaBeanVouchermanagementandreportanalysissystem[Abstract]AfterjoiningtoWTOChinawillfacethecompetitiontofinanceindustryfromoverseasthusourcommercialbanksmustthinkabouthowtoanalyzethebusinessdatamorescientifically.WiththisbackgroundwedeveloptheVouchermanagementandreportanalysissystem.TryingtouseJ2EEininformationmanagementdomainanddatastatisticsdomainthesystemuseJ2EEstructuretheMVCpatternandtheStrutsframework.Thissystemwillhelpthebankmanagermanagethedealingrecordandgetvaluableinformationfromthem.[Keyword]J2EEStrutsB/SMVCJavaBean目录中文摘要Abstract第1章绪论11.1引言11.2研究背景与研究意义11.3工作内容21.4论文组织结构2第2章J2EE相关技术介绍32.1J2EE(Java2EnterpriseEdition)32.2MVC模式42.3Struts框架52.4本章小结6第3章系统总体架构设计73.1总体功能框架73.2应用系统的数据流向83.3部分组件的的设计83.3.1数据事件对象(Event)83.3.2数据访问对象(DataAccessObject)93.4本章小结10第4章部分模块的设计与实现114.1登陆界面114.2凭证管理模块的设计与实现124.2.1凭证管理顺序图124.2.2界面实现134.3报表分析模块的设计与实现164.3.1相关名词的说明164.3.2操作流程图184.3.2界面实现184.4本章小结24第5章部分技术难点的实现255.1Struts中分页显示的实现255.1.1searchResult.jsp255.1.2PaginationBean.java265.2金额转换的实现275.2本章小结32第六章总结33致谢语34参考文献35第1章绪论1.1引言当前随着技术的日益进步传统的软件开发两层结构正逐渐转变为多层体系结构但在带来巨大的灵活性的同时也增加了创建、测试、配置、管理和维护应用组件的复杂性;企业、公司纷纷需要参与到Internet中来各种业务都进入了网络这些企业级应用的快速增长促使其需要一个强壮的、企业级的、以web为中心的应用结构来支撑。以J2EE技术为代表的分布式对象技术和组件技术为解决上述的种种问题提供了一条很好的途径。J2EE技术的运用降低了开发多层服务的成本和复杂性使企业面对新的需求能够迅速部署和增强服务极大地提高软件的生产率。本系统对J2EE技术的采用充分体现了其技术优点。1.2研究背景与研究意义在金融领域尽管目前正在进行数据大集中但是仍然有许多的业务数据需要手工以书面形式传送。这种重复工作加大了业务处室的工作负担在一定程度上也影响工作效率